Expect works that don’t always follow conventional rules, but instead open up new perspectives on what audiovisual practice can be and do.

Storyline

  • Soft Limits by Kjettil Gerritsen. Short film. Through different voices, Soft Limits explores how freedom is personally experienced, translating intimate stories into poetic visual worlds. Contains photosensitive content (flashing lights).
  • Casa Amarela by Marina dos Anjos Hardy. Short film. Celina is a young immigrant woman who returns home to heal from illness under the care of her family, where together they navigate how distance changed their connections. 
  • Carry-On by Skaistė Šileikaitė. Short film. While waiting at an airport gate to leave her hometown, a traveler drifts through a landscape of memories, facing the emotional baggage she carries. As she does, her former self slowly dies, making way for a new version of her to emerge. 
  • Protozoa by Zef Oosterhof. Short film. Protozoa, a lonely fluke of nature, faces Earth’s evolutionary winner, the mussels, to stop their evil plot of devolving all other life on Earth into complete extinction. Trigger warning: Contains photosensitive content (flashing colours and light effects).
  • Miserere by Jarmo Willering. Short film. An exploration of humanity’s never ending attraction to self-destruction and the end of the world. Trigger warning: Contains graphic violence or injury detail. Photosensitive content (flashing lights). Advisory age: 14+
  • The Endless Voyage by Suzanne Lub & Rada Skumova. Short film. A luxury ark flees a collapsing world, but the greed onboard proves heavier than the flood outside  Advisory age: 9+
